San Rafael Catholic Mission
San Rafael Catholic Mission is a church in Emery, Utah which is located on UT 10. San Rafael Catholic Mission is situated nearby to the peak Allens Hill, as well as near the hamlet Lawrence.| Tap on a place to explore it |
- Type: Church
- Denomination: Roman Catholic
- Address: 1716 UT 10, Huntington, UT 84528

Huntington
Village
Photo: Tricia Simpson,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Huntington is a city in northwestern Emery County, Utah, United States. The population was 1,914 at the 2020 census. It is the largest town in Emery County. Huntington is situated 2 miles north of San Rafael Catholic Mission.
